- INTRODUCTION Tyco Electronics Crimping Die Assembly 59993–1 is used to crimp Size 8 coaxial RF 50–ohm and non– impedance matched straight pin and socket contacts onto various types and sizes of coaxial cable. The die assembly is used with Hand Crimping Tool 69710–1 or 69710–2, or 626 Pneumatic Tooling Assembly 189721–2 or 189722–2 fitted with “C”– HEAD Pneumatic Adapter 318161–1. The die assembly can also be used with Pneumatic Tool 69365–8. For cable–to–contact selection, refer to Catalog 82074. Refer to 408–2095 for instructions concerning operation of the hand tool and 409–5862 for 626 pneumatic tooling assembly. DESCRIPTION (Figure 1) The die assembly consists of a indenter (stationary die) and anvil (movable die), both of which contain two crimping chambers. The small crimping chamber crimps the center contact, and the large crimping chamber crimps the ferrule. Each die is held in the tooling by a single screw. 3. CRIMPING PROCEDURE Install dies according to the instructions packaged with the tooling. Then proceed as follows: The tools are designed to accept interchangeable crimping dies and are used to crimp a variety of product. Make certain that the selected contact and cable are compatible with the die assembly. 3.1. Center Contact 1. Prepare and assemble the center contact according to 408–6755. 2. Position contact assembly in the center contact crimping chamber so that the indenter aligns with the port hole of the contact. See Figure 2. 3. Close dies (according to the instructions packaged with the tool) onto contact until the indenter starts to enter the contact port hole. Align the other port hole over the anvil. When using Pneumatic T ool 69365–8, pull the handle (located on take–up attachment) forward to close dies on contact. 4. Holding cable and contact in position, actuate tool through a complete cycle to crimp the contact. 5. Remove contact assembly from tool. Crimping Chamber Gage Element Diameter GO NO-GO “W” Width (Max) Center Contact 0.940-0.947 [.0370-.0373] 1.013-1.016 [.0399-.0400] -- Ferrule 3.200-3.208 [.1260-.1263] 3.325-3.327 Suggested Plug Gage Design GO Diameter NO-GO Diameter Center Contact Die Closure Configuration Ferrule Die Closure Configuration W Inspection of Crimping Chamber GO element must pass completely through the crimping chamber. NO-GO element may enter partially, but must not pass completely through the crimping chamber. Crimping Chamber
